    Day 3: Golden Monkey tracking – visit twin lakes of Ruhondo and Burera.

    Wake up early for a cup of coffee at your hotel and drive to volcanoes atonal park offices and assemble for briefing by 7:00 am. Golden monkey tracking starts the same time as gorilla trekking and This tour is a good way to get adjusted to the altitude, which when tracking the gorillas can be at elevations from 7,000 to 9,000 feet, and it offers a taste of what to expect on the mountain gorilla trek if visitors do this first.”It’s a shorter walk to the golden monkeys than the mountain gorillas” since the gorillas are found at the higher altitude says Semivumbi after you will drive back to the lodge for  lunch at your hotel.

    This afternoon you will drive to visit twin lake of Burera and Ruhonda very scenic and relaxing both lakes are located Between Musanze and the Ugandan border are two scenic lakes usually referred to as the twin lakes;Lake Bulera and Lake Ruhondo. … of the landscape most visitors prefer to drive up the small track leading to a lodge situated on the top of the hill overlooking both lakes to enjoy the scenery and have a refreshing drink.

    Day 10: Second Gorilla Trekking in Bwindi forest / Gahinga national park

    after breakfast you will drive to the range station and have a briefing about the gorillas in the forest and other animals and the also sprit in the groups of 8 people to enter the Bwindi national park for Gorilla Trekking, Bwindi forest offers a real jungle adventure, the forest is also a home of other animals like forest elephants, lions, buffalos with a lot of birds and better to come with binoculars. Bwindi has a tropical climate. Average temperatures range from a minimum of 7-20°C to a maximum of 20-27°C. Bwindi receives up to 2390mm of rain each year. It can get really cold especially in the mornings and at night. After gorilla trekking you will drive back to the lodge to relax and maybe a village walk in the evening.

    Day 12: Morning Game Drive – Afternoon Launch Cruise along the Kazinga Channel

    After your breakfast, you will go for the morning game drive in Kasenyi area to search for different wildlife animals missed out in the previous game drive including hyenas, buffalos, elephants, kobs, lions, leopards e t c . Later visit the Katwe explosion craters. Here you will spot Kitagata Lake and the enormous Kamengo Crater and this will give you clear view of different wildlife around the Park.

    In the afternoon we will go for a launch trip along the Kazinga Channel. This gives you the opportunity to view wildlife up close: hippo’s huff and spray at a mere feet away from the boat, buffalo linger in the shallows. The shores of the channel are also home to an array of birds including pink backed pelicans, pied and malachite kingfishers, saddle billed stork and many others.
